What Causes Low Blood Pressure in Women: Hormones to Anemia

Low blood pressure, defined as a reading below 90/60 mmHg, affects women more often than men, largely because of hormonal fluctuations that directly relax blood vessels. Some causes are unique to women, like pregnancy and menstrual cycle shifts, while others, like dehydration and medication side effects, simply hit harder or more frequently in female bodies.

How Hormones Lower Blood Pressure

Progesterone, one of the two primary female sex hormones, is a natural vasodilator. It works by blocking calcium from entering the smooth muscle cells that line blood vessel walls. Since calcium is what makes those muscles contract and tighten, progesterone essentially keeps vessels relaxed and wide open. Research from the American Heart Association found that progesterone reduced calcium-driven constriction in blood vessel cells by roughly 64%. This effect happens directly at the cell membrane, meaning it kicks in quickly rather than going through the slower hormone-receptor pathway.

This is why blood pressure isn’t static across the menstrual cycle. During the menstrual and proliferative phases (roughly the first two weeks of the cycle), when progesterone is low but estrogen is rising and vessels are relatively relaxed, systolic pressure averages around 104 to 105 mmHg. In the luteal phase (the two weeks before a period), progesterone is high, but so is the body’s compensatory response, and systolic pressure climbs to about 124 mmHg. The diastolic pattern follows the same trend, from around 64 mmHg during menstruation up to 76 mmHg in the luteal phase. Women who already run on the low side may notice dizziness or lightheadedness in the first half of their cycle as a result.

Pregnancy and Blood Pressure Drops

Pregnancy is the single most dramatic cause of low blood pressure in women of reproductive age, and it starts earlier than most people expect. Blood vessels begin dilating as early as five weeks of gestation, well before the placenta is fully formed. By mid-second trimester, peripheral vascular resistance drops 35% to 40% below pre-pregnancy levels, which causes blood pressure to fall 5 to 10 mmHg below baseline. That nadir typically hits around weeks 16 to 20, though most of the initial drop happens between weeks 6 and 8.

The body tries to compensate. Cardiac output increases by up to 45% by 24 weeks. Heart rate rises 20% to 25% above normal. Plasma volume expands significantly, starting at 6 to 8 weeks and continuing to rise until around 28 to 30 weeks. But plasma volume grows faster than red blood cell production, creating a dilution effect sometimes called “physiological anemia.” This combination of wider blood vessels and thinner blood is why many pregnant women feel faint, especially when standing up quickly or lying flat on their backs.

For most women, blood pressure gradually recovers in the third trimester and returns to normal after delivery. But during those middle months, even women who have never had blood pressure issues can experience noticeable symptoms.

Dehydration and Blood Volume Loss

Your blood pressure depends on having enough fluid in your bloodstream to maintain pressure against vessel walls. When blood volume drops, pressure drops with it. Women lose blood during menstruation, which reduces volume directly. Heavy periods compound this, sometimes enough to cause symptoms like lightheadedness in the days during and after bleeding.

Beyond menstrual losses, everyday dehydration from not drinking enough water, vomiting, diarrhea, or heavy sweating during exercise all shrink blood volume. Even mild dehydration can trigger weakness, dizziness, and fatigue, particularly when standing. The body normally detects a pressure drop through sensors called baroreceptors, which signal the heart to beat faster and the blood vessels to tighten. But when fluid loss is significant, this system can’t fully compensate, and blood pressure stays low.

Orthostatic Hypotension

Orthostatic hypotension is the specific type of low blood pressure that hits when you stand up from sitting or lying down. Gravity pulls blood toward your legs, and your body is supposed to respond within seconds by tightening blood vessels and increasing heart rate. When that response is too slow or too weak, blood pressure drops and you feel dizzy, lightheaded, or like your vision is going dark.

Women are particularly susceptible during pregnancy, during the early menstrual phase, and when dehydrated. But orthostatic hypotension can also be a side effect of medications or a sign of an underlying condition affecting the nervous system. If it happens repeatedly, it’s worth tracking when it occurs and what you were doing beforehand, since the pattern often points toward the cause.

Medications That Lower Blood Pressure

Several common drug classes can cause or worsen low blood pressure. Diuretics (water pills), often prescribed for bloating or high blood pressure, work by reducing fluid volume, which directly lowers pressure. Blood pressure medications themselves can overshoot, especially if a dose was set when pressure was higher and circumstances have changed. Antidepressants, particularly older tricyclic types and some SSRIs, can interfere with the nervous system’s ability to regulate vascular tone. Beta-blockers slow heart rate, which may lower pressure too much in some women.

If you started a new medication and began feeling dizzy, fatigued, or faint within days or weeks, the timing is a strong clue. This is one of the most common and most fixable causes of low blood pressure.

Nutritional Deficiencies and Anemia

Iron, vitamin B12, and folate are all essential for producing healthy red blood cells. When any of these nutrients are insufficient, the body produces red blood cells that are either too few or too large and poorly functioning. These abnormal cells carry less oxygen, and the reduced oxygen delivery can contribute to low blood pressure along with fatigue, pale skin, and shortness of breath.

Women of reproductive age are at higher risk for iron-deficiency anemia because of monthly blood loss through menstruation. Vegetarian and vegan diets can increase the risk of B12 deficiency specifically, since B12 comes primarily from animal products. Folate deficiency is less common but can develop during pregnancy, when the body’s folate demands roughly double.

Endocrine Disorders

The adrenal glands sit on top of each kidney and produce hormones that regulate blood pressure. In adrenal insufficiency (Addison’s disease), the glands don’t make enough aldosterone or cortisol. Aldosterone controls sodium and potassium balance, and without enough of it, sodium drops too low. Since sodium helps retain water in the bloodstream, low sodium leads directly to low blood volume and low blood pressure. In severe cases, the combination of very low cortisol, low blood sugar, and low sodium can become life-threatening.

Thyroid disorders, which affect women at roughly five to eight times the rate they affect men, can also play a role. An underactive thyroid slows heart rate and weakens the heart’s pumping force. An overactive thyroid can cause blood vessels to dilate excessively. Either scenario can push blood pressure lower than normal.

Other Contributing Factors

Prolonged bed rest reduces the body’s ability to adjust to position changes, leading to drops in pressure when you finally stand. Eating large meals diverts blood to the digestive tract, which can lower pressure for one to two hours afterward, a pattern called postprandial hypotension that’s more common in older adults. Severe infections and allergic reactions cause sudden, widespread blood vessel dilation that can drop pressure dangerously fast.

Some women simply have constitutionally low blood pressure with no identifiable cause. If readings consistently run below 90/60 but you feel fine, have good energy, and aren’t experiencing dizziness or fainting, it’s generally not a problem. Low blood pressure only becomes a medical concern when it produces symptoms or drops suddenly from your personal baseline.
